How often should you get an oil change?

  • Follow the owner’s manual for the 2008 Toyota Land Cruiser; typical intervals are every 5,000 miles or 6 months with conventional oil, and up to 7,500–10,000 miles with high-quality synthetic oil, depending on driving conditions.
  • Frequent towing, short trips, or extreme temperatures justify more frequent changes to protect the 5.7L engine.

What type of oil does a 2008 Toyota Land Cruiser take?

  • Toyota-recommended oil for the 5.7L V8 is typically SAE 5W-30 for broad temperature ranges; consult your owner’s manual for exact specifications.
  • Synthetic or synthetic blend oils offer superior thermal stability, reduced oxidation, and longer change intervals—ideal for towing or high-mileage use.

How much oil does a 2008 Toyota Land Cruiser need?

  • The 5.7L V8 in the 2008 Toyota Land Cruiser typically requires approximately 6.0 quarts (about 5.7 liters) of oil with a filter change; confirm in the owner’s manual.
  • Using the correct oil volume and a genuine oil filter maintains proper oil pressure and engine protection.
